What is Xenical?

Xenical is a prescription medication developed to deal with obesity. Unlike lots of other weight-loss drugs that act as appetite suppressants by impacting the main nerve system, Xenical operates locally within the digestive system. Its primary function is to prevent the absorption of a part of the fats taken in through the diet plan.

The Mechanism of Action

The active component, Orlistat, is a potent inhibitor of intestinal lipases. These are the enzymes accountable for breaking down dietary fats (triglycerides) into smaller sized fatty acids that the body can soak up. When Xenical is taken with a meal, it attaches to these enzymes, preventing them from functioning.

As an outcome, approximately 25% to 30% of the fat consumed in a meal travels through the intestine undigested and is eliminated from the body through bowel motions. By decreasing  Xenical Kapseln kaufen  from fat, the body is forced to use its saved fat reserves for energy, resulting in weight-loss over time.

The German Healthcare Framework: Prescription and Availability

In Germany, the regulation of pharmaceuticals is stringent, supervised by the Federal Institute for Drugs and Medical Devices (BfArM). Xenical (120mg Orlistat) is strictly categorized as a rezeptpflichtiges Medikament, suggesting it is just offered with a legitimate prescription from a licensed doctor.

Contrast: Xenical vs. Over-the-Counter Alternatives

While Xenical needs a prescription, a lower-dose version of Orlistat is available over-the-counter (OTC) in German pharmacies (Apotheken). The following table highlights the crucial distinctions:

FeatureXenical (Prescription)Alli/ Orlistat HEXAL (OTC)
Active IngredientOrlistat 120 mgOrlistat 60 mg
Legal StatusPrescription Only (Rezeptpflichtig)Pharmacy Only (Apothekenpflichtig)
StrengthBlocks ~ 30% of dietary fatBlocks ~ 25% of dietary fat
Medical SupervisionNeededAdvised but not required
Main TargetBMI ≥ 30 (or ≥ 28 with risks)BMI ≥ 28

Eligibility Criteria for Xenical Treatment

In Germany, medical professionals usually adhere to particular standards when recommending Xenical. It is not intended for people seeking to lose a couple of "vanity pounds" however rather for those whose weight poses a significant health risk.

Prospects for Xenical generally fall into the following classifications:

  • Obese Individuals: Those with a Body Mass Index (BMI) of 30 or higher.
  • Obese with Comorbidities: Individuals with a BMI of 28 or greater who also struggle with weight-related conditions such as Type 2 diabetes, high blood pressure (high blood pressure), or high cholesterol.

Dietary Requirements and Lifestyle Integration

One of the most crucial elements of Xenical therapy is the "Xenical Diet." Since the medication avoids fat absorption, the undigested fat remains in the colon. If a patient takes in a meal exceedingly high in fat, they are likely to experience unpleasant intestinal adverse effects.

For Xenical to be efficient and well-tolerated, clients are advised to follow a nutritionally well balanced, calorie-reduced diet. The daily consumption of fat, protein, and carbs ought to be topped three main meals.

  • Fat Intake: Typically, about 30% of the total daily calories need to come from fat.
  • Consistency: The medication must be taken with each primary meal containing fat. If a meal is skipped or consists of no fat, the dosage needs to be omitted.

Prospective Side Effects and Safety Profile

The side impacts related to Xenical are mainly "treatment-emergent intestinal results," suggesting they are straight related to the fat-blocking action of the drug.

Typical negative effects consist of:

  • Oily identifying in underwears.
  • Flatulence with discharge.
  • Urgent or increased need to have a defecation.
  • Oily or fatty stools (Steatorrhea).

Essential Safety Considerations:

  • Malabsorption of Vitamins: Because fat-soluble vitamins (A, D, E, and K) need fat for absorption, Xenical can reduce their levels in the body. German doctors frequently advise taking a multivitamin supplement at bedtime, at least 2 hours after the last dosage of Xenical.
  • Contraindications: Xenical is not ideal for people with persistent malabsorption syndrome, cholestasis, or those who are pregnant or breastfeeding.

The Cost and Insurance Coverage in Germany

A substantial consideration for patients in Germany is the cost. Xenical and its generics are usually categorized by statutory medical insurance (Gesetzliche Krankenversicherung - GKV) as "way of life medications."

  • Self-Payment: In the majority of cases, clients should spend for the prescription out-of-pocket. The cost can vary depending on the pack size (e.g., 42, 84, or 126 capsules).
  • Personal Insurance: Some private medical insurance service providers (Private Krankenversicherung) may cover the costs if the medication is deemed medically required to deal with severe comorbidities, though this requires prior explanation with the service provider.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. How long can one take Xenical?

In Germany, Xenical is generally prescribed for long-lasting management, but its effectiveness is examined after the first 12 weeks. If  Xenical Lieferung Deutschland  has not lost at least 5% of their body weight in that time, the medical professional may reassess whether to continue the treatment.

2. Can I drink alcohol while taking Xenical?

While alcohol does not interact straight with Xenical, it is high in "empty calories." For weight loss success, German health specialists recommend minimizing alcohol consumption.

3. Does Xenical connect with the contraceptive tablet?

Xenical does not directly interfere with hormonal contraceptives. However, if Xenical causes severe diarrhea, the absorption of the contraceptive pill could be jeopardized. In such cases, additional contraceptive approaches are suggested.

4. Are there generic variations available in Germany?

Yes, generic versions containing Orlistat 120mg are available in German pharmacies. These are frequently more affordable than the initial brand-name Xenical while providing the exact same effectiveness.

5. What occurs if I eat a very high-fat meal?

Taking Xenical with a very high-fat meal (such as deep-fried quick food) considerably increases the risk of severe intestinal adverse effects, including involuntary oily leakage and intense cramping.
